About Kuoni Travel
A Heritage Built on Wonder
Kuoni was founded in 1906 in Zurich, Switzerland, and has spent over a century doing one thing exceptionally well — creating unforgettable travel experiences. Today, it operates as a key brand under the Dertour Group in the UK, with its official home at www.kuoni.co.uk.
What sets Kuoni apart from most travel companies isn’t just its longevity — it’s the philosophy behind every itinerary it builds. The brand has long been known for taking complex travel plans and turning them into seamlessly personalised journeys that match each traveller’s unique style and brief.
At the start of 2025, Kuoni unveiled its first rebrand in 15 years. The refresh introduced a bold new yellow identity, reintroduced the iconic globe to its logo, and signalled a broader shift in the brand’s ambitions — moving beyond its celebrated reputation for special occasions to become a go-to choice for families, solo adventurers, and wellness seekers as well. YouGov data confirmed that the rebrand was already driving improvements in brand health and consideration, particularly among family travellers.

Kuoni Tumlare — World-Class Destination Management
While most travellers know Kuoni through its holiday packages, there’s another side to the brand that operates behind the scenes of global tourism. Kuoni Tumlare is one of the world’s most established destination management companies (DMCs), operating as a subsidiary of JTB Corporation — one of the largest travel groups in Japan. Kuoni Tumlare manages group travel and cultural exchange programmes across dozens of countries, connecting people and cultures at scale.

The Kuoni Gift List
For couples planning a wedding, the Kuoni gift list is one of the most thoughtful and popular features the brand offers. Rather than receiving traditional gifts, couples can invite friends and family to contribute towards their honeymoon — funding flights, hotel nights, spa treatments, excursions, and more. It transforms the wedding gift experience into something genuinely meaningful and memorable.
